Following several failed launch attempts due to mechanical difficulties, the Space Shuttle Endeavor blasted off on it's final mission this morning under the command of Mark Kelly, the husband of Arizona Rep. Gabrielle Giffords. The wounded congresswoman watched the launch in private from Kennedy Space Center.

This will be the second-to-last shuttle launch ever, with the June 28 liftoff of Atlantis marking the official retirement of program.